The nRF51822 and nRF51422 join the Nordic Semiconductor nRF51 series of systems-on-chip (SoC), offering the full functionality of their quad-flat no-lead (QFN) counterparts in a 3.5- by 3.8- by 0.5-mm wafer-level chip-scale package (WLCSP) in a 13-mm2 footprint that takes up 40% less board space. Used with an integrated balun design available for the series from STMicroelectronics, the SoCs can save as much as 80% of the board space of conventional QFN and discrete component designs. According to the company, they represent the world’s smallest Bluetooth low energy (BLE) and ANT+ SoC solutions, serving any application where space is severely constrained including smart fashion and sports watches, wearable sports and fitness sensors, medical sensors, portable smart-phone accessories, hearing aids, and smart cards. The devices are available immediately.
